A Peculiarity In Time

It is said time moves ever onward…at a slow and steady climb… but there is a wrinkle in that theory…a peculiarity in time. The time that’s measured by our clocks marches forward…absolutely The time that ages our once young bodies advances resolutely. But there is a category, a kind of time that plays by different rules defying all the lessons we once were taught in school. It’s when old friends get together…for no matter how much time’s amassed suddenly they are young again...as if time has never passed. This is the wrinkle in the time continuum, a wrinkle all friends know allowing them to pick up from where they left off years ago. And for the time they’re back together…they feel a certain thrill standing in a moment…where time is standing still… If you want to see this wrinkle in time…it’s simple… watch as old friends come together…then… keep watching for the moment when they are young again.
